Ciena is evolving its Supply Chain into a process‑centric, workflow‑orchestrated, and digitally enabled operating model. This role plays a pivotal part in translating business strategy into scalable, governable, and automation‑ready end‑to‑end processes that deliver measurable outcomes. Reporting to the Director, Supply Chain Process & Digital Transformation, this position bridges strategy, operations, and digital enablement to ensure process change creates sustained business value.

How you will make an impact:
  • Design and evolve end‑to‑end Supply Chain process architecture (Tier 1–4) aligned to business outcomes and transformation priorities
  • Translate strategic objectives such as growth, cost‑to‑serve reduction, and resilience into executable process designs and operating models
  • Define clear business rules, decision logic, handoffs, and controls that enable orchestration and automation
  • Lead business process design for enterprise workflow and business process management (BPM) platforms such as Pega
  • Partner with Supply Chain, Information Technology (IT), and architecture teams to ensure business intent is accurately implemented
  • Establish and monitor process performance metrics to drive prioritization, continuous improvement, and value realization
  • Enable a shift from functional silos to end‑to‑end process ownership across the Supply Chain

The must haves:
  • 5–8+ years of experience in process management, business process transformation, operational excellence, or digital enablement
  • Hands‑on experience with BPM, workflow, or orchestration platforms (Pega strongly preferred; Appian, ServiceNow, Camunda, or equivalent)
  • Proven ability to translate business strategy and operational objectives into executable process designs
  • Experience partnering closely with IT and technology teams on digital implementations
  • Strong end‑to‑end process design skills with the ability to operate beyond functional silos
  • Ability to clearly articulate business rules, decision logic, and workflows
  • Bachelor’s degree in Business, Operations, Engineering, Information Systems, or a related field

Nice to haves:
  • Supply Chain domain experience across planning, order management, procurement, fulfillment, logistics, or service supply chain
  • Experience supporting enterprise process orchestration or workflow enablement initiatives
  • Familiarity with process performance measurement, automation coverage, and exception management
  • Certifications in Lean, Six Sigma, Business Process Management (BPM), or process improvement disciplines
  • Experience contributing to reusable standards, templates, and process design best practices
  • Comfort operating in ambiguous, evolving transformation environments

What you need to know about the San Francisco Tech Scene

San Francisco and the surrounding Bay Area attracts more startup funding than any other region in the world. Home to Stanford University and UC Berkeley, leading VC firms and several of the world’s most valuable companies, the Bay Area is the place to go for anyone looking to make it big in the tech industry. That said, San Francisco has a lot to offer beyond technology thanks to a thriving art and music scene, excellent food and a short drive to several of the country’s most beautiful recreational areas.

Key Facts About San Francisco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
  •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
  •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
